The online CPD presentation introduces Concrete Canvas® and the broader category of Geosynthetic Cementitious Composite Mats (GCCMs) and Geosynthetic Cementitious Composite Barriers (GCCBs), highlighting their development, composition, installation process, and applications within civil engineering.
GCCMs are described as new class of Geosynthetic material combining the impermeability of a geomembrane with the durability of concrete. GCCBs are for secondary containment applications.
The session outlines the main advantages of GCCMs, including rapid installation, reduced environmental impact, minimal equipment requirements, and consistent quality relative to traditional sprayed or poured concrete.
Case studies demonstrate successful use in slope and channel protection, bund lining, culvert lining, and remediation projects where access constraints, schedule limitations, or difficult terrain made conventional concrete impractical.
